Tom Brown, who was well known on the UK folk scene, has sadly passed away in late August. He made a number of CDs with his wife, Barbara Brown, at Wild Goose Studios. Although I did not know him well, he was always friendly towards myself and my wife.

I'm surprised not to see more tributes to Tom. He and Barbara sang together and ran music clubs in west London for many years before moving to Combe Martin in Devon, where they were also running music events. They were a key element in Broadstairs festival with their singaround sessions. A lovely, warm and supportive man who had a wealth of knowledge about traditional music and folklore. He will be hugely missed.
